Hi! Today i am sharing this ‘moodboard shaker tags’ project

I started with die cutting the shape of the tags.
I used dies from Nellie’s Choice.
I die cutted it with Neenah Dessert Storm cardstock. I die cutted every die twice for one tag. That is needed to create the shaker effect.
I created little windows in the front pieces of the tags. I used dies from Nellie’s Choice.
I glued at the back of the front piece some acceta. So the windows are closed.
I added al around the window a strip of double sided foam tape. I doubled this up so the sequins can move free.
I used my anti-static tool around the edges from the double sided foam tape. I placed the sequins on the accetate and closed it with the back side of the tag.
I stamped the images from Create A Smile Stamps -floral decorations and -superpowers on the same kraft cardstock. I colored them with Bruynzeel pencils.
I added some high-lights with a white Sakura Gelly Roll pen.
I fussycutted the images out.
I placed them on the shaker tags with glue and foam squares.
I die cut the little words from Create A Smile Stamps -cool cuts Tiny sentiments.
I inked two of them with Distress Oxide inks worn lipstick and tumbled glass.
I glued them on the tags.
I added some wax thread at the top of the tags.
